University of Maryland Medical Center Patient Satisfaction

What Patients Say

Were you satisfied with your stay? Here's what a sample of recent patients told this hospital when asked a series of questions. Almost 4,000 other hospitals now use the same survey, created by the federal government. Responses are posted on Best Hospitals and on the federal Hospital Compare page.
